About Kathryn L. Black
Kathryn L. Black is a scholar working on Health, Molecular Biology and Dermatology, having authored 11 papers that have together received 387 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(4 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(3 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(3 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(2 papers), CAR-T cell therapy research (2 papers), Cancer-related gene regulation (2 papers), Cutaneous lymphoproliferative disorders research (1 paper) and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Biology (281 citations), Oncology (82 citations) and Aging (5 citations). Kathryn L. Black has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Hugh W. Brock, Alexander Mazo, Svetlana Petruk, Jacob W. Hodgson, Yurii Sedkov, Samantha Beck, Eli Canaani, Andrei Thomas‐Tikhonenko, Asen Bagashev and Elena Sotillo. Their work appears in journals such as Cell, Nucleic Acids Research and Nature Communications.
